  5. Use the return 1 input for one mono signal and the return 2 for the other mono signal. Insert return block 2 after return block 1(mix 50%) and you have a mixed signal Or you can use a splitted path (return 1 block in path 1A and return 2 in path 1B, for example) Then you can add a mix block, stereo effects and the stereo send 1+2 block.

  14. Have you try to make a reset? (5+6 on boot restores Global parameters or fs 9+10 on boot restores presets, setlists, globals and IRs (restores factory bundle) "THIS WILL OVERWRITE ALL USER PRESETS AND SETLISTS) Can you enter update mode (fs6+12) and reinstall the firmware? Otherwise I think it's a hardware problem and you have to open a support ticket.

  17. Turn off the Helix and close all line6/audio software. Reinstall HX Edit (2.82) - When you get to the options section of the install, leave them all checked. Start the Helix with FS6 and FS12 pressed (update mode) Start the LINE 6 Updater. (...don't use a USB-HUB, try annother USB-port if it still does not work use annother computer for the update)
